深入解析区块链的计算机网络及其应用

      
              

              什么是区块链的计算机网络?

              区块链是一个去中心化的分布式账本技术,其核心在于通过多个节点(即计算机)共同维护一份记录,以保证数据的安全性和透明性。区块链的计算机网络指的就是这些参与该区块链协议的计算机系统的集合,这些系统通过网络相互连接,进行数据的共享与验证。正是这种分布式的特性使得区块链在很多行业中展现出巨大的潜力。

              区块链网络可以分为公有链、私有链和联盟链三种类型。公有链是任何人都可以参与的网络,像比特币和以太坊;私有链是由特定组织控制的网络;而联盟链则是几个组织共同维护的网络。不同类型的区块链适用于不同行业和应用场景,可以满足从小规模企业到大型机构的需求。

              区块链网络的工作原理

              区块链网络的工作原理涉及多个关键过程,包括节点机制、共识算法、记录处理等。首先,节点是参与区块链网络的计算机,每个节点都保存一份完整的区块链数据。当有新的交易发生时,数据将被广播到整个网络,所有节点都会接收到该交易信息。

              接下来,区块链网络需要通过共识算法来验证这笔交易是否有效。常见的共识算法包括工作量证明(PoW)、权益证明(PoS)等。经过共识后,交易被打包成一个新的区块并添加到区块链中,这个过程确保了数据的不可篡改性。

              每个新加入的区块都会包含前一个区块的哈希值,这样形成的链条保证了数据的安全性。即使是网络中的部分节点出现故障,整个区块链依然能够正常运行,因为其他节点能够继续维护网络的功能。

              区块链网络的安全性

              安全性是区块链网络的另一大亮点,它通过去中心化架构和加密技术有效保护数据。由于没有单个控制中心,攻击者如果想要篡改某个数据,必须同时控制网络中超过半数的节点,这是极其困难的。

              此外,区块链技术使用了各种加密算法确保数据传输的安全,例如哈希函数和对称加密。这使得除非拥有足够的计算资源和时间,否者黑客无法有效地解密信息或者篡改数据。

              综上所述,区块链的计算机网络在安全性、透明性和去中心化等方面表现优异,使得其在金融、医疗、物流等各个领域广泛应用。

              区块链网络的实际应用案例

              区块链技术的应用领域非常广泛。以下是几个重要的应用案例:

              首先是在金融领域,区块链可以用于跨境支付和汇款。传统的跨境支付需要通过中介机构,处理时间往往很长,但基于区块链的支付解决方案可以即时完成交易,减少了时间和成本。

              其次,在供应链管理中,区块链可以有效地提升透明度和可追溯性。通过在每个供应链环节中记录数据,所有参与者都可以查看产品的来源和流动,防止伪劣产品流入市场。

              医疗数据管理也是一个热门应用。通过区块链,患者的医疗记录可以被安全存储并共享,患者对于自己健康信息的控制权则得以提升。同时,这也为医疗机构提供了数据共享的便利。

              总之,随着技术的不断发展,区块链的应用前景将更加广阔,未来可能会出现更多创新的应用场景。

              区块链网络如何影响未来的技术发展?

              区块链网络不仅改变了交易的方式,也将对技术未来的发展产生深远影响。首先,去中心化的理念正在推动传统行业的转型,不再依赖单一中心化的软件或平台。随着去中心化应用(DApps)的兴起,开发者可以以更灵活的方式设计应用,提高了创新的可能性。

              其次,区块链在智能合约的帮助下,能够实现自动执行合约条款,减少人为干预。这将会在未来的商业合作中,提升效率和透明度。随着越来越多的企业认识到区块链的潜力,未来可能有更多的新商业模式被创造出来。

              此外,由于区块链具有的可追溯性和透明性,政府和相关机构也可以利用区块链提升公共服务的效率,例如在投票系统、土地注册等方面,都可以改善数据的透明性和安全性。

              总的来说,区块链技术的成熟将呈现出一场技术革命,其影响效果将会在未来的社会经济结构中逐渐显现。

              区块链计算机网络的挑战与改进方向

              虽然区块链技术具有很多优势,但在实际应用中也面临着一系列挑战。首先是技术瓶颈,当前的区块链网络仍然存在扩展性问题。尤其是在交易量大时,很多区块链网络的处理速度会下降,需要更多的技术改善和创新。

              其次是能耗问题,尤其是使用工作量证明的共识机制,消耗了大量的电能,造成环境负担。越来越多的研究者和开发者正努力寻找更环保的共识算法,例如权益证明和分片技术,以实现可持续发展。

              另外,由于区块链的透明性,个人隐私保护也是一个亟待解决的问题。如何在保证数据透明的前提下,保护用户的隐私,是未来发展中必须面临的挑战。

              最后,法律法规问题也是区块链技术发展的障碍。随着区块链技术的不断发展,如何监管和管理这些新兴技术,使其顺利合法地运作,将是各国政府需要认真考虑的问题。

              可能相关的问题

              1. 区块链与其他技术有什么区别?

              区块链与其他技术的最大区别在于其去中心化的特点。传统的数据库系统是由一个中心控制的,所有数据由这个中心管理和维护。而区块链则允许每个参与者都有相同的权限来访问和验证数据,避免了资源的单点损坏,提升了系统的可靠性。同时,区块链使用加密和哈希技术保护数据,增强了安全性。

              另外,与云计算相比,区块链不需要依赖第三方服务,用户可以自己控制数据和交易,提升了隐私保护。区块链还实现了交易的不可篡改性,而许多传统系统无法做到这一点。总而言之,区块链是技术革新的重要组成部分,其与众不同的特性让它在数字经济和各行各业中具有广泛的应用潜力。

              2. 区块链技术有何前景?

              区块链技术的前景被各行各业所看好。近年来,随着大众对区块链技术的认识加深,越来越多的企业开始探索其潜在的应用场景。在金融领域,区块链可以提升交易效率,减少成本;在医疗行业,它能够确保数据的安全性和可追溯性;在物流管理中,区块链为供应链带来透明性与信任。

              此外,区块链的智能合约技术赋能各类合同与协议的自动执行,可以大幅降低各方的信任成本。同时,治理方面,区块链技术可以提升公共服务的透明度,从而改善政府与民众的关系。未来,随着技术的进一步完善,区块链或将成为构建分布式经济的基础设施。

              3. 区块链在金融领域的应用前景如何?

              区块链技术在金融领域的应用前景非常广阔。从跨境支付到资产发行,区块链都展示了其优越性。例如,使用区块链进行的跨境支付能够显著减少中介机构,提高交易速度。而且,因为区块链是去中心化的,多个银行和金融机构可以共享同一数据,增加了透明度,降低了错误率。

              在证券交易上,区块链技术使得资产发行和交易流程更加简化,资产的转移只需简单的数字签名,潜在地降低了交易成本。还可以通过资产代币化,促进对小额资产的交易,可以实现更为灵活的投资方式。

              尽管存在监管和法律挑战,但区块链在金融领域的潜力和实际应用场景已逐渐被认可,未来的发展值得期待。

              4. 区块链在医疗领域的应用如何?

              在医疗行业中,区块链技术能够提升电子健康记录系统的安全性与效率。通过区块链,患者的医疗记录可以以去中心化的方式保存,确保只有授权的医生能够访问,增强了数据的隐私保护。同时,医疗机构之间的数据互通将变得更加方便,提升了协同工作效率。

              在临床试验阶段,区块链可以用来追踪药物的开发过程,确保数据的完整性,防止伪造临床试验结果。通过实现数据的透明性,患者和医疗提供者均可以知晓药物的开发进展和有效性,这将使医药公司在道德上承担更多的责任。

              总体而言,区块链在医疗领域的应用前景广阔,但如何克服技术障碍、法律难题和行业标准化问题,将是未来重大的挑战。

              5. 如何选择合适的区块链平台?

              在选择合适的区块链平台时,有几个关键因素需要考虑:首先是项目的需求,是选择公有链、私有链还是联盟链;其次是平台的技术架构,包括共识机制、可扩展性、交易速度及安全性;再者是已有的开发者社区和支持,活跃的社区能够提供更多的资源和技术支持。

              此外,成本也是一个重要因素,每个区块链平台的使用和维护成本不同。在考虑技术稳定性的同时,也要考虑潜在的未来能否进行升级和扩展。最后,是否符合行业法规和标准也是选型过程中必须关注的点。

              经过综合考量,企业可以选择最适合自己需求的区块链平台,以助于实现项目的成功。

              通过上面的分析,我们可以看到区块链的计算机网络在未来的广泛应用及影响,将会是科技进步的重要方向之一。希望通过本篇文章读者能对区块链有更深入的了解,并能够在相关领域中进一步探索。
                    author

                    Appnox App

                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                related post

                                                leave a reply